编程私活一般都有什么软件

worktile 其他 1

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程私活一般需要使用的软件主要包括开发工具、编辑器和版本管理工具等。以下是常用的几种软件:

    1. 开发工具:根据具体的编程语言和开发需求选择相应的开发工具。常见的开发工具有:

      • Java开发工具:Eclipse、IntelliJ IDEA、NetBeans等。
      • Python开发工具:PyCharm、Jupyter Notebook、Spyder等。
      • C/C++开发工具:Visual Studio、Code::Blocks、Dev-C++等。
      • Web开发工具:Visual Studio Code、Sublime Text、Atom等。
      • 移动应用开发工具:Android Studio、Xcode等。
    2. 编辑器:用于编写代码和文本编辑的工具。常见的编辑器有:

      • Visual Studio Code:支持多种编程语言,拥有丰富的插件生态系统。
      • Sublime Text:轻量级、快速、强大的文本编辑器,支持多种编程语言。
      • Atom:开源的文本编辑器,可定制性强,支持多种编程语言。
      • Notepad++:Windows平台下的文本编辑器,支持多种编程语言。
    3. 版本管理工具:用于管理代码的版本和协同开发。常见的版本管理工具有:

      • Git:分布式版本控制工具,广泛应用于各种项目中。
      • SVN:集中式版本控制工具,适用于小型项目和团队。
      • Mercurial:分布式版本控制工具,与Git类似,但使用更简单。

    除了以上列举的软件,根据具体的开发需求还可能需要使用其他辅助工具,例如数据库管理工具、调试工具、测试工具等。选择合适的软件可以提高编程效率和开发质量,根据自己的需求和偏好进行选择。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在进行编程私活时,一般会使用一些常见的软件工具来辅助开发和提高效率。以下是一些常见的软件工具:

    1. 集成开发环境(IDE):IDE 是程序员开发的核心工具,提供了代码编辑、编译、调试、版本控制等功能。常见的 IDE 包括:Visual Studio、Eclipse、IntelliJ IDEA、Xcode 等。

    2. 版本控制工具:版本控制工具可以帮助程序员管理代码的版本,并协同多人开发。常见的版本控制工具有:Git、SVN 等。

    3. 编辑器:除了 IDE,有时候程序员还会使用纯文本编辑器进行简单的代码编辑。常见的编辑器有:Sublime Text、Atom、Notepad++ 等。

    4. 虚拟机:虚拟机可以在同一台计算机上运行多个操作系统,用于开发和测试不同平台的应用程序。常见的虚拟机软件有:VirtualBox、VMware Workstation 等。

    5. 数据库工具:在开发过程中,经常需要与数据库进行交互。数据库工具可以帮助程序员管理数据库、执行 SQL 查询等。常见的数据库工具有:Navicat、SQL Server Management Studio、MySQL Workbench 等。

    6. 前端开发工具:如果私活涉及到前端开发,常见的前端开发工具包括:WebStorm、Sublime Text、Visual Studio Code 等。此外,还可以使用浏览器的开发者工具进行调试和优化。

    除了上述常见的软件工具,根据具体需求和项目的特点,可能还需要使用一些特定的软件。例如,移动应用开发可能需要使用 Android Studio 或 Xcode;数据分析可能需要使用 Python 的数据分析库(如 Pandas、NumPy)等。此外,还需要根据项目需要选择合适的操作系统、数据库等。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在进行编程私活时,常用的软件可以分为以下几类:

    1. 集成开发环境(IDE):IDE是开发者进行编程的主要工具,提供了编辑、编译、调试等功能。常见的IDE有:Visual Studio、Eclipse、IntelliJ IDEA、PyCharm等。选择IDE时可以根据自己的编程语言和个人喜好进行选择。

    2. 版本控制工具:版本控制工具可以帮助开发者管理代码的版本,进行代码的追踪和协同开发。常见的版本控制工具有:Git、SVN等。使用版本控制工具可以保证代码的安全性和可追溯性。

    3. 调试工具:调试工具可以帮助开发者定位代码中的错误和问题,并进行代码的调试和修复。常见的调试工具有:GDB、Xcode、Chrome开发者工具等。使用调试工具可以提高代码的质量和效率。

    4. 数据库管理工具:数据库管理工具可以帮助开发者管理数据库的结构和数据。常见的数据库管理工具有:MySQL Workbench、Navicat、SQL Server Management Studio等。使用数据库管理工具可以方便地进行数据库的设计、查询和维护。

    5. 项目管理工具:项目管理工具可以帮助开发者进行项目的计划、任务分配和进度跟踪。常见的项目管理工具有:JIRA、Trello、Microsoft Project等。使用项目管理工具可以提高项目的组织和管理效率。

    6. 文档管理工具:文档管理工具可以帮助开发者管理项目的文档和资料。常见的文档管理工具有:Confluence、OneNote、Google Docs等。使用文档管理工具可以方便地进行文档的编写、共享和协同编辑。

    除了以上列举的软件,还有很多其他的辅助工具和库可以根据具体需求进行选择和使用,比如代码编辑器(Sublime Text、Atom、Notepad++等)、图形设计工具(Photoshop、Sketch等)、项目构建工具(Maven、Gradle等)等。根据不同的编程语言和项目需求,可以选择适合自己的软件工具来提高开发效率和质量。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部